Your phone needs MORE than 20% battery to start a video call. Not exactly 20% more than it! That is an inequality: a statement that a variable must satisfy a range condition, not one exact value. Unlike equations with a single answer, inequalities give you a whole set of solutions you can draw on a number line. Speed limits, minimum exam scores, safe medicine doses the real world is full of inequalities. Today we solve, graph, and interpret linear inequalities with one unknown.
